Like medical insurance, dental insurance policy works by sharing the costs of dental care in exchange for a costs you pay. You may additionally have to pay deductibles, copays and other expenses, but the details vary from plan to strategy. Below are some common terms of dental insurance policy strategies: A costs is what you pay your insurance company in exchange for insurance coverage.


A typical premium may be $20$50/month for an individual or $50$150/month for a household based on the kind of coverage (https://marys-awesome-site-c274d4.webflow.io). 1 An insurance deductible is the amount you pay towards certain dental costs prior to your insurance coverage starts. : if you have a $1,000 deductible, you pay the initial $1,000 of covered services and then a taken care of quantity (ex-spouse.


Deductibles normally reset after 12 months. Coinsurance is a repayment you may be in charge of after you fulfill your deductible. For instance: if your oral plan pays 70% of the expense, your coinsurance settlement is the remaining 30% of the price (teeth restoration). A yearly optimum is the restriction your oral insurance will certainly pay towards the price of oral therapy in a strategy year.

Dental amalgam has a large amount of mercury. If you have a high amount of mercury in your body, you can pass it to your baby through the placenta or when nursing.


Mercury additionally can create damages to the brain, kidneys and various other body organs. You must not get dental amalgam fillings if you are pregnant, intending to get expecting or nursing, according to the U.S. Fda (FDA). If you require to have actually a dental caries filled, ask your dental expert for a mercury-free composite resin filling.


It is made from a type of plastic blended with powdered glass. Compound resin fillings do not consist of poisonous steels such as mercury and are risk-free for you and your child. The FDA does not recommend that you remove any kind of dental amalgam filling that you currently have unless your dentist claims that there is a problem with the dental filling.
